No-Bake Chocolate Ganache Layer Cake

This cake takes rum balls to a whole new level, adding cream and ganache for an incredible layered dessert that is so simple to make. Make it pareve or dairy, according to your personal preference. A great activity for kids who want to help out on Erev Shabbos!

Directions

For the Base

1.

Break the tea biscuits into fairly big pieces.

2.

Place chocolate, butter (or margarine, or oil), sugar, and milk into a saucepan. Stir over medium heat until you have a smooth cream. Remove from heat and add the tea biscuits.

3.

Mix well and pour into a 9- x 13-inch baking pan. Freeze.

For the Topping

1.

Beat cream for the topping with vanilla pudding until firm. Spread over biscuit mixture in pan.

2.

Freeze for two hours.

For the Ganache

1.

Melt chocolate in a microwave or a double boiler. Add the cream and mix with a whisk until well blended. (If using dairy cream, you can heat it in a pot first to make it easier to mix.)

2.

Pour over cake and smooth with a spatula.

3.

Return the pan to the freezer until ready to serve.
